Determine which kind of swap is best for you. The most common option is the swapping of primary residences, in which case both parties are vacationing at exactly the same time in each others' homes. If you own more than one home, you can engage in nonsimultaneous swaps so you could go at another time than the person with whom you are swapping. With this type of swap, you may be able to exchange timeshares and vacation rentals. Another sort of nonsimultaneous exchange could involve inviting a man to stay at home while you're there, and vice versa.
A Short Term Apartment Rentals in Lower Plenty VIC understanding should include the address of the property being leased, the dates and times the renter will have access to the property, age, and maximum occupancy rules, payment policies, check out procedures, cancellation policies and the rules associated with the property, like rules regarding pets, smoking, and pool or utility use. If the property is located in a place where hurricanes or storms may occur, a clause may be added if there's a mandatory evacuation that allows for refunds or cancellations.

If you own a vacation rental house, you should have a lawyer look over your rental agreement to be sure that it's in conformity with all relevant laws. Also, make sure that your agreement complies with all rules and covenants that may be distinctive to the location of your home's, like a homeowner's or condominium association. Both the renter and the property owner should sign and date the agreement, and a copy should be kept by both parties.
Determine whether you need to list your vacation property through a property management company or if you need to record it yourself. A third party is a great alternative for those who don't want to handle paperwork, the renter screenings, and trade. Bear in mind that a management firm also can be hired to take care of difficulties and maintenance which could appear with renters. This is especially useful should you not possess time to rectify a tenant's trouble on short notice or if you do not live close enough to the property to handle problems promptly.

The contract should also include a cancellation policy that'll discourage a renter from backing out of the trade. The contract should contain a good faith clause which will release the renter from the contract if a catastrophe happens before the rental and renders the property uninhabitable if the property is in a location prone to natural disasters including hurricanes, floods or earthquakes.
Have all conditions in writing for the vacation home rental. The contract must say the location of the property, dates of rent payment program, total rental price and leasing. Any individual policies like policies relating to pets, smoking, and occupancy limits also must be in the contract. Contain a damages clause, which sets financial repercussions involving any damages done to the property and deposit rules.
